When a homeowner visited the home depot to buy what he thought he needed to fix a leaking toilet, he gathered up materials total

ing almost $70. one his way to check out, an employee asked him what was he trying to fix. after some discussion, the employee convinced the homeowner that a $5.99 replacement part would fix the problem better than the materials he thought he needed and with less trouble. this sort of discussion between employees and customers is commonplace at the home depot and indicates the retail store has a(n) _____ orientation. (2pts) sales market product exchange production?

The answer to this question is "Market Orientation" such as when the homeowner <span>visited the home depot to buy what he thought he needed to fix a leaking toilet, he gathered up materials totaling almost $70. When on his way to check out, an employee asked him what was he trying to fix. After some discussion, the employee convinced the homeowner that a $5.99 replacement part would fix the problem better than the materials he thought he needed and with less trouble. This kind of discussion between employees and customers is commonplace at the home depot and indicates the retail store has a MARKET orientation.</span>
